To implement a weblogic cluster that meets the highavailability and scalability requirements of your j2ee application, you must understand the elements that constitute a weblogic clustering environment as well as the. Recall also that recovery or repair is an important aspect of availability. High availability infrastructure for cloud computing kai yu oracle solutions engineering lab. In the it world minimizing downtime is very important, and in order to implement a new configuration into an. In a multiserver architecture, it is best not to use psserver defined exactly the. Instead of clustering application servers, high availability is provided by running multiple domains and using software loadbalancing and failover. High availability architectures and solutions oracle. Hi, it sounds like you already found this document which is a good start. In software engineering, multitier architecture often referred to as ntier architecture is a clientserver architecture in which presentation, application processing, and data management functions are. High availability architectures oracle help center. The oracle maximum availability architecture offers a choice of architecture patterns for high availability and scalability.
When setting up an application in a crosscloud architecture, planning is. Architectures to deploy oracle apps on azure virtual machines. Oracle white paperdeploying an oracle peoplesoft maximum availability architecture 3 introduction. Software architecture for high availability in the cloud. High availability software is software used to ensure that systems are running and available most of the time. Unlike virtual machine software, docker accomplishes this by sharing the host operating system kernel and using kernel functionality to create an isolated workspace. Amazon web services configuring amazon rds as an oracle peoplesoft database page 4 certification, licensing, and availability before getting started with installing a peoplesoft application on amazon rds for oracle, check for certification, make licensing considerations, and verify general availability. Oracle database maximum availability oracle maa maximum availability architecture is oracles best practices blueprint based on proven high availability and recommendations. High availability in azure can be achieved by setting up two oracle databases in two availability zones with oracle data guard, or by using oracle database exadata cloud service in oci. To improve performance and provide high availability ha, oracle peoplesoft supports using a hardware or software load balancer.
The rich functionality enables customers to design cloud applications with optimal high availability, security, performance, and cost. High and maximum availability architectures oracle the. The original architecture for the peoplesoft suite of products built on a. The goal of maa is to achieve the optimal high availability architecture at the. In this blog post we will briefly look at some of the technical capabilities of oracle 12. Soft servers can be named peoplesoft1 and peoplesoft2. An introduction to high availability architecture filecloud. Infoq homepage presentations architectural patterns for high availability upcoming conference. Operational prerequisites to maximizing availability oracle. Software engineering stack exchange is a question and answer site for professionals, academics, and students working within the systems development life cycle. Ibm power systems for oracle peoplesoft applications. Peoplesoft architecture on amazon availability zones azs are distinct geographic locations that are engineered to insulate against failures in other azs.
This article compares high availability architectures and gives best practices. High jump software, which develops an rfidenabled supply chain execution system that runs on windows. Jaggy offers database highavailability design and implementation services for oracle, mysql, sql server, and db2 databases. High availability infrastructure for cloud computing. Exadata x3 database for high availability same architecture and price as x2. High availability is a key requirement for critical database applications.
Bill burton joined oracle in 1998 and is currently a member of the development rac assurance team. This document is a companion to the introduction to high availability for sap hana com docsdoc65585 and answers some frequently asked questions. Architectures to deploy oracle apps on azure virtual. Peoplesoft software is installed on several servers, each server with a specific type of duty. Announcing the oracle cloud infrastructure architecture. Peoplesoft can be run in a single availability domain or multiple availability domains. Peoplesoft announces rfid software as target issues. Peoplesoft application provides outofbox high availability by using tuxedos domain failover mechanism. Highavailability application architecture wikipedia. Resiliency and high availability reference architecture. They describe architectural topology and include stepbystep instructions to help with deployment. Here, the entire web application is deployed in two different azs for high availability. High availability architectures and best practices evidian.
Application availability cisco ace product family application optimization services for high peoplesoft hrms 8. Use this architecture when you want to set up a disaster recovery site for your application in a different region. Oracle maximum availabiity architecture peoplesoft maa on exalogic and exadata 7 3 peoplesoft maximum availability architecture overview peoplesoft maximum availability architecture maa is a peoplesoft high availability architecture. The tactics we discuss in this section will keep faults from becoming failures or at least bound the effects of the fault and make repair possible. Edwards to deliver high availability cluster solution. High availability for sap hana sap software solutions. The design of high availability architectures is largely based on the combination of redundant hardware components and software to manage fault correction and detection without human intervention. Within a peoplesoft system all application server processes belong to a domain.
In the above definition, high availability is a design and implementation that ensures a certain degree of operational continuity, and application architecture refers to the actual concept and design of implementing a new configuration into the particular system. Collaborated with ezcorp teams to define and build oracle cloud sdn, network acls, high availability architecture, configured the peoplesoft cloud manager, and established network connectivity. Hello allcurrently our clients edi transaction processing system is on oracle bpel 10. This paper describes the peoplesoft maximum availability architecture and the required operations and configuration practices to maximize peoplesoft availability against unplanned outages and minimize downtime for planned maintenance activities. High availability in azure can be achieved by setting up two oracle databases in. Oracle white paperdeploying an oracle peoplesoft maximum availability architecture 7 figure 2. Ezcorp successfully deploys peoplesoft on oracle cloud.
The clusters that are typical of rac environments can provide continuous service for both planned and unplanned outages. It can be formally defined as 1 down time total time100%. A model that describes the structure of a software system in terms of computational components, the relationships among components, and the constraints for assembling the components. The infrastructure or architecture of peoplesoft has changed very little since the introduction to the peoplesoft internet architecture or pia. Roadmap to implementing the maximum availability architecture oracle high availability solutions and sound operational practices are the key to successful implementation of an it infrastructure. Configuring amazon rds as an oracle peoplesoft database.
Performed the initial peoplesoft software installation on the cloud and restored the database on the cloud servers. Peoplesoft software is installed on several servers, each server with a. Rac only architecture uses real application clusters and is an inherently high availability system. Cisco application networking for peoplesoft enterprise. Rac build higher levels of availability on top of the standard oracle features. The joint solution offers optimized peoplesoft hrms 8. Oracle database high availability strategy, architecture and solutions doag nuremberg 170920. Understanding the various aws services and how they can be leveraged will allow you to deploy secure and scalable oracle peoplesoft applications, no matter if your organization has 10 users or 100,000 users. If you are new to db2 on distributed platforms, or even if you have been using it for a while, you may find the array.
The patterns below address the design and architectural consideration to make when designing a highly available system. Clustering and high availability for peoplesoft oracle. Clustering and high availability for enterprise tools 8. High availability is a high percentage of time that the system is functioning. Risc architecture that spans applications from consumer electronics to. Oracle 12c and high availability how is it achieved. This section discusses the high availability deployment of the peoplesoft application software that is layered on top of the database maa foundation. Resilience, availability and scalability best practices. Application clustering sometimes called software clustering is a method of turning. Oow19 enterprise application best practices in oci rainfocus.
That is, a software architecture can be defined in terms of the following elements. Singleavailabilitydomain, multipleregion architecture the following architecture is for peoplesoft on oracle cloud infrastructure in a singleavailabilitydomain region with the disaster recovery dr site built in another oracle cloud infrastructure region. The architecture is valid for peoplesoft deployments done manually or by using peoplesoft automation tools on oracle cloud infrastructure. If anybody had similar requirements and has implemented. Can not install other software can not spread cluster nodes. Additionally, some may be physically separate machines while others may be logical servers more on that a. Peoplesofts rfid strategy hinges on its partnerships with supply chain software maker manhattan associates. Advanced replication setup for high availability and performance in my personal opinion, oracle leads the market in directory product offerings ldap directories. Architecture to deploy peoplesoft while ensuring high availability and disaster recovery. Oracle application server provides high availability and disaster recovery solutions for maximum protection against any kind of failure with flexible installation, deployment, and security options. Oracle database high availability architecture a large electric utility company was rearchitecting their oracle rac environment on a sun cluster in order to improve performance for their peoplesoft erp databases, utility management systems and billing system applications. Edwards software delivers new levels of availability to critical supply chain, erp and crm applications, enabling the it infrastructure to. High availability, clustering, load balancing and failover in peoplesoft. Azure architecture azure architecture center microsoft.
Oracle weblogic clustering and high availability architectures are supported natively including support for the load balancing facilities supported, whether they be hardware or software based. Starting from oracle internet directory oid, to the latest oracle unified directory oud, oracle definitely provides variety of ldap directory related products for integration. In this section we discuss the high availability deployment of the peoplesoft application software that. If you use data guard or oracle goldengate for high availability, disaster recovery, and data protection, oracle recommends that you perform regular application and database switchover operations every three to six months, or conduct full application and database failover tests. The software is distributed or deployed to other servers and clients from this server. Availability is the degree to which an application and database service is available. Best practices in high availability architecture to ensure optimal performance. Oracle database high availability overview 3 for a thorough introduction to oracle database high availability products, features, and best practices. Oracles peoplesoft application suite contains software for human. Use multiple availability zones for high availability. Advanced replication setup for high availability and. These white papers provide design patterns and best practices to help you rapidly deploy popular application workload solutions on oracle cloud infrastructure. With netscaler, enterprises can not only enable high availability for their oracle peoplesoft environments, but.
In chapter 1, we give some background for availability and software architecture and architecture patterns styles, and. A set of standard reference architectures, bronze, silver, gold, and platinum, that provide application transparent scalability with oracle rac, data protection, high availability, and disaster recovery for the oracle database. Such systems may also need a high availability solution for planned maintenance operations such as upgrading a systems hardware or software. Cloud architecture failures failures in traditional, machinebased physical and virtual architectures tend be hardware and operating system oriented, and most highavailability engineering is focused on providing redundant hardware and operating systems to provide fault tolerance. Download the peoplesoft internet architecture diagram by clicking here.
Although the oracle cloud infrastructure documentation site is a fantastic repository for service and productrelated content, we saw an opportunity to highlight architecture assets. Deploying an oracle peoplesoft maximum availability architecture. Although the minimum required availability varies by task, systems typically attempt to achieve 99. As part of a proposal for migrating to oracle soa suite 10. Oracle soa suite high availability architecture oracle. Powered by the ontap software, thinksystem dm5000f delivers enterpriseclass storage management capabilities with a wide choice of host connectivity options and enhanced data management features. High availability and performance the highperformance engine and proven data movement and management capabilities of sap data services include. Automating peoplesoft environments in the aws cloud.